Salatiga is a cozy city on the island of Java, in Indonesia, often referred to as "Little Holland." Situated at the foot of the majestic Merbabu volcano, it charms visitors with its fresh, cool climate and picturesque green landscapes, creating a special atmosphere of tranquility and harmony with nature.

With a population of about 175,000 people, Salatiga is an important administrative center in the Central Java region. Despite its status, the city has managed to preserve the unique charm and coziness of a provincial town with a rich history and distinctive culture, making it particularly attractive to travelers.
